A systematic pattern for progressively exploring and understanding unfamiliar codebases through iterative context refinement.

Start with broad exploration:
# Find entry points
find . -name "main.*" -o -name "index.*" -o -name "app.*" | head -20
# Discover project structure
tree -L 3 -I 'node_modules|dist|build'
# Find configuration
find . -name "*.config.*" -o -name "package.json" -o -name "*.toml"
# Identify key patterns
grep -r "export class" --include="*.ts" src/ | head -20
grep -r "def " --include="*.py" . | head -20

Discover: Find similar existing features
grep -r "feature-name" src/
find . -name "*feature*"
Evaluate: Review implementation patterns
cat src/features/similar-feature/index.ts
Refine: Check tests and edge cases
cat src/features/similar-feature/*.test.ts
Loop: Trace dependencies until clear
Discover: Locate error origin
grep -r "error message" src/
git log -S "error message"
Evaluate: Understand surrounding context
cat path/to/file.ts | grep -A 20 -B 20 "error location"
Refine: Check call sites and callers
grep -r "functionName" --include="*.ts" src/
Loop: Expand context as needed
Discover: Map current structure
find src/ -name "*.ts" | xargs wc -l | sort -n
grep -r "class\|interface" --include="*.ts" src/ | wc -l
Evaluate: Identify coupling points
grep -r "import.*from.*module" src/ | cut -d: -f2 | sort | uniq -c | sort -rn
Refine: Find all usages
grep -r "ComponentName" --include="*.ts" src/
Loop: Ensure all references found
After each loop iteration, document:
## Iteration N
**Query**: What I was looking for
**Found**: X files, Y patterns, Z components
**Relevance**: High/Medium/Low with reasons
**Gaps**: What's still unclear
**Next**: What to explore in next iteration
**Key Files**:
- path/to/file.ts - Core implementation (★★★)
- path/to/other.ts - Supporting utility (★★)
**Mental Model Update**:
- New understanding of X
- Connection between Y and Z
- Pattern: Description
